Just got off today. We had brown water in our cabin sink briefly and only once and it didn't last long. As far as the Vero water goes, we only had 1 glass bottle in our cabin. It was being served by staff at all bars and restaurants with glass bottles that they refilled. The bottles came in still and sparkling and were only handled by staff and never left on our table. Spring and still waters were available at the gangway and Horizons as mentioned above, We also found bottled spring water on the jogging track in a cooler.
